Abstract
In this work, the effect of process parameters such as stabilizer concentrations and plating bath temperature of the electroless Ni-P on efficiency and crystallinity are investigated. Both the nickel recovery and coating efficiencies are defined, quantified and analyzed by varying the above stated basic input process parameters. The integral breadth, crystallite size, microstrain and the relative proportions of amorphous and crystalline phases present in the coating are obtained using the X-ray diffraction technique and analysed.
